In 2018 City Council determined that a stable and sufficient source of revenue was needed to ensure that Hamilton could continue to maintain and improve the quality of its existing public street system. The council passed Ordinance No. 07-18 where occupants of developed property (residential and commercial) would provide funding for the maintenance of the city’s streets.

Maintenance to:1) Provide a safe street system2) Properly maintain the street system and areas to maximize their use, utility, and longevity3) Maintain certain landscaped areas within the street rights-of-way4) Provide maintenance for streets used by pedestrians, bicyclists, and mass transit users as well as those used by vehicle drivers5) Take any other action necessary to ensure that existing city streets are maintained at standards that support the needs of city residents, businesses, and institutions
